Superconductivity of Bi0.25-ySr0.25-yCa2yCu0.5Ox (y=0.1, 0.125, 0.15)

Abstract
Resistivity and magnetic susceptibility of superconducting Bi0.25-y Sr0.25-y Ca2y Cu0.5O x (y=0.1, 0.125, 0.15) have been measured and compared with the results of X-ray powder diffraction. The volume fraction of the low-T c phase (T c∼75 K) decreases as the Ca concentration is increased and superconductivity attributed to the high-T c phase (T c>100 K) is observed. Resistivity of Bi0.125Sr0.125Ca0.25Cu0.5O x shows a sharp transition above 100 K and becomes zero at 97 K.
